Legal fees for immigration cases vary based on the specific type of application and the complexity of your situation. Factors that shift the cost include the volume of documentation needed, whether you have prior legal issues, or if your case requires appearing before a judge. While simple filings might be more straightforward, cases involving appeals or extensive background work take more attorney time. We focus on providing a clear path forward.
